Angela Bassett is grieving the passing of 9-1-1 crew member Rico Priem, who tragically passed away after a 14-hour shift on the ABC series.

Bassett, who is 65 years old, expressed her heartfelt condolences to Priem's friends and family in an interview with Entertainment Tonight on Tuesday, May 14. She shared that everyone on the set of 9-1-1 was deeply saddened by the loss and described it as a very sad moment that has affected them all.

Bassett shared that while working on the seventh season of the series, the cast and crew have celebrated “births” and “weddings” together. However, this is the first time they are dealing with loss. She mentioned that they took a moment on set to pay tribute to Priem, with many heartfelt words spoken about him.

“We felt it was important to come together and show our support to his family,” Bassett continued. “We will miss him, but we know that his family will miss him even more. It was a time for us to offer whatever comfort and assistance we could.”

Priem, a grip and crew member of International Alliance of Theatrical Stage Employees Local 80, tragically passed away in a car accident after his shift on Saturday, May 11. His Toyota Highlander veered off the road and overturned. He was declared deceased at the scene, with the Los Angeles County Medical Examiner later confirming his identity.

IATSE also confirmed Priem's death, expressing their deep condolences to his family. The organization emphasized their unwavering commitment to the safety and well-being of all members. In a statement, IATSE stated, "Workers have the right to expect a safe journey to and from work. It is unacceptable for anyone to be endangered while simply trying to earn a living."

Following the tragic passing of Rico Priem, the show's studio, 20th Television, expressed their heartfelt condolences to his family and friends. The AMPTP (Alliance of Motion Picture and Television Producers) also sent their sympathies, stating that their thoughts are with Priem's loved ones and all affected by this unfortunate loss.

One of Priem's colleagues, Nina Moskol, a fellow grip, mentioned that they had recently worked together just last week.

"He was almost ready to retire, with all his paperwork sorted out," she shared on Instagram on Sunday, May 12. He had big plans for retirement - spending time with his wife, watching his grand-nephew grow up, riding his beloved Harley, and staying connected with friends. He was excited to share his retirement wisdom with others in the local community.

She pointed out that the most dangerous times of the day are the commute to work and back home. She emphasized the importance of staying safe on the road - drive carefully, take breaks if needed, and prioritize safety above all else.

Aisha Hinds, known for her role as Henrietta on the firefighter drama, also expressed her sadness over Priem's passing in a heartfelt statement on Instagram.

In her post alongside a 9-1-1 promo image, she wrote about the deep impact of Priem's death on the 9-1-1 family. She highlighted his dedication to his craft and the wisdom he shared from his years of experience in the industry.

Hinds emphasized the importance of the crew, referring to them as the "unsung heroes" and "cornerstones" of the show. She highlighted individuals like Priem who play a vital role in turning creative ideas into lasting memories cherished by humanity.

Reflecting on Rico's passing on Saturday, May 11th, Hinds expressed the shock and sadness felt by the team. Rico's presence and passion had made a significant impact, and his absence has left a void that has prompted deeper conversations and a renewed focus on supporting one another.

She ended her tribute by expressing her "deep love" for the 9-1-1 crew members. She also mentioned that she was sending a gentle prayer to the sacred soft spots in his family's hearts that are hurting because of his absence.
